          Greetings All,

          I've ordered the PCB and ESP from @PCR. I'm looking at the BuyDisplay.com page, and want to confirm some selection items before ordering.

          • Pin Header or FFC connection for the 4-wire SPI?
          • Power Supply Type (3.3 or 5.0V)?
          • Font chip (instructions say one isn't needed, but there is no selection for no chip -- so would any of the selections work?)

          https://www.buydisplay.com/lcd-3-5-inch-320x480-tft-display-module-optl-touch-screen-w-breakout-board

          Also @PCR - you mention needing 2 20-pin male connectors and that you were thinking of including them... Did you include them, or should I source those elsewhere?

          Thanks!

          John

            Sounds wrong: Leading zero is not valid in IPv4 I think. Try 192.168.1.69. Make sure there is no space in front of the password and IP.

            @JohnOCFII

            • Pin header for PCRs PCB
            • 3.3V (5V works as well but not with the PCB of PCR as far as I remember - just a wiring thing)
            • Just select nothing for the font chip. Leave it to the page default --Please Select--. However font chip or not should not make any difference.

                    Changed the ip to 192.168.1.69 but the RepPanel is still not showing the printer.
                    Upon further investigation, looking at the connections to my router, my printer is not shown. This is very strange because the printer works perfectly, controlled by my computer or phone.
                    So it appears that the RepPanel can't find the printer because its not listed.
                    Any ideas why the Duet is not listed on the connections page of the router whilst all other connections are shown?

                    PLEASE IGNORE THE ABOVE

                    RepPanel is now working, the problem was that in config I did not have " " around Machine name - M550 or password - M551
                    As soon as I corrected this everything worked, although The printer is still not shown on the connections page of the router.

                                        While trying to start the ESP32/PCB and attached touch screen the monitor window shows that the touch panel is found but there is an error whille trying to read from the device. What could cause this?
                                        ...
                                        I (210) ILI9488: ILI9488 initialization.
                                        I (510) ILI9488: Enabling backlight.
                                        I (510) FT6X36: Found touch panel controller
                                        E (510) FT6X36: Error reading from device: ERROR
                                        I (510) FT6X36: Device ID: 0x00
                                        I (520) FT6X36: Chip ID: 0x00
                                        I (520) FT6X36: Device mode: 0x00
                                        I (530) FT6X36: Firmware ID: 0x00
                                        I (530) FT6X36: Release code: 0x00
                                        ...

                                        1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                        • seeul8erundefined
                                          seeul8er
                                          last edited by

                                          @KenOlo "Found touch panel controller" just indicates that the FT6X36 driver is being inited. It does not say anything about a successful init. If you can not read from the device there is no connection.
                                          I get that the message is not 100% clear at this point.

                                          I suggest you check your connection and if you got the correct display

                                            @seeul8er Found the problem. My touch panel was configured for 5v, some soldering on jumper JP and it's now configured for 3,3v. Problem solved and it works perfectly!
